copyright AZ Time Zone: Mountain Standard Time Explained
Understanding the area time zone can seem somewhat complicated for visitors . copyright, Arizona, primarily observes Mountain Standard Time (MST) year-round . Unlike most other states in the United States, Arizona doesn't switching to Daylight Saving Time (DST) in virtually all of the counties. Consequently , residents in copyright have MST throughout the entire year. It's important to remember that the Navajo Nation, that a portion of Arizona, may observe DST.
